This book was a satisfying journey through cosmology of the past 100 years with a particular focus on gravitational lensing as a key method that scientists employ today for their discoveries.Gravitational lensing derives from Einstein's General Relativity. As we learn in detail, general relativity shows that spacetime itself is impacted by surrounding mass and energy. If spacetime were shaped like a trampoline, its shape would change if a massive object (stars, galaxies, planets, or in this analogy a bowling ball) were placed on it. Light follows this curvature, so the massive object serves almost like a lense between the light source and Earth. It's a fascinating concept and described with lucid analogies from everyday experiences to help digest the concepts.Gravitational lensing has surprisingly versatility. Scientists are able to view light sources of much greater distances than thought possible and evaluate the masses of objects without the need to individually count each star. The mass of these objects proved to be far greater than expected by the amount of mass visualized in conventional telescopes. This indirectly detectable mass is termed dark matter and comprises about 23% of total mass/energy in the universe. The author shows how scientists confirmed its existence and current attempts thus far to understand it. After discussing the current science of dark matter, she explains the discovery of dark energy in 1998 and various attempts to explain the accelerating expansion of galaxies from one another.
